Unlike the more widely known migraine headache, a cluster headache occurs most often in men instead of in women. However, they do affect people of a similar age range, from between fifteen to fifty five, making them almost like a migraine type of headache that is tailor made for men. Generally, a cluster headache will last for quite some time and may even last for days on end in a chronic fashion. After a cluster headache cause has set events in motion to create this type of headache, you may begin noticing symptoms immediately. Compared to other types of headaches, a cluster headache comes on rapidly and severely and looks to be attributed to a sudden release of various biochemicals into a person’s bloodstream.

The most common people to experience a cluster headache include individuals who smoke or drink alcohol. This has led researchers to determine that alcohol and tobacco may be two important cluster headache cause factors. Alternatively, a cluster headache cause has also been attributed to stress and dietary habits.
